Output 74c2d71b002e79d351a0dd19163d818a26682c07dc07b768530d2f0e06056761:1

value
850511
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1afa7295fbe8680e833bf7578a6d654d05ae6aea OP_EQUAL
address
349fWwE4ge2rZPEQktPf4YrAxPk1ytofr6
transaction
74c2d71b002e79d351a0dd19163d818a26682c07dc07b768530d2f0e06056761
confirmations
241076
spent
true